NDRRMC: 12 dead, Infra and Agri damage at P2.33 B to three storms 

by Kiko Cueto

THE National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Council (NDRRMC) said that more than 3.5 million Filipinos were affected by Storms Nika, Ofel and Pepito.

Likewise, in their latest situation report, a total of 12 deaths had been reported. Some 14 were injured and 3 missing.

Of the said number, five fatalities and 11 injured had been validated.

On the other hand, 3,507,920 persons of 939,936 families were affected. Of the said number, 84,913 families or 300,953 persons are inside 2,331 evacuation centers, and 36,974 families or 128,899 persons that were outside evacuation centers.

A total of 541 road sections and 120 bridges were affected. 

The estimated cost of damage to infrastructure is now at P2,032,677,190. While for agriculture, it is estimated at P29,507,934.91.

A total of 29 cities/municipalities were declared under the State of Calamity.

Some P226,782,311.473 in assistance were provided to those affected by the storms.
